Use

You can send data for additionals to a store using the assortment list IDoc. This data cannot, however, be printed in the assortment list.

Integration

The assortment list IDoc contains all the fields relevant to additionals.

Prerequisites

The procedure for additionals must be flagged in Customizing as being relevant for assortment lists.

Features

When an assortment list IDoc is generated, the system checks whether data for additionals needs to be included in the list. Any such data is copied to the assortment list IDoc if the following criteria are fulfilled:

If you have set the corresponding indicator against a procedure for additionals in Customizing, the additionals that belong to this procedure will be adopted in the assortment list.

Triggering events include: creating new articles to be sold with simultaneous assignment of additionals; subsequent assignment of further additionals to an article to be sold; or changes to a text for an additional.

Triggering events include: changing sales prices for articles if the prices are recalculated; or changing sales prices for articles for a promotion.

Entries containing information about changes to additionals are flagged accordingly in the assortment list IDoc.

Note

With local price changes (when a store reduces prices to undercut the local competition, for example), the initiative is store-based. In this case, therefore, responsibility for generating tickets must be assumed by the store retailing system.

To print labels or tickets you require a translator (or converter) that converts the IDoc data from the SAP system to the required printer format. The standard system does not contain any of this type of converters. (See also: Additionals).
